The traditional ruler of Candoso in Ayobo-Ipaja Local Council Development Area of Lagos State, High Chief Moroof Aremu Owonla a.k.a. Kaka, has commended the state’s Commissioner for Local Government and Chieftaincy Affairs, Mr. Ademorin Kuye for his efforts in ensuring peaceful coexistence among traditional rulers.

Owonla, who is also the proprietor of Impressive Group of Schools and Rosebol Filling Station both on Ashipa road, Ayobo, said he was very impressed with the wisdom being applied by the commissioner, adding that Kuye’s experience as a former local government chairman will a great advantage for his new office.

The traditional ruler said he was impressed with the commissioner over his keen interest on crisis resolution in local governments and most especially, among the royal fathers in the state.

According to him, “without mincing words, Kuye is a grassroots man, who truly understands the problems of the people at the grassroots, the traditional system of administration and equally vast in local governance, having administered Somolu Local Government in the past.” Owonla said he had once had the opportunity to interact with the lawyer turned politician and was quick to note that he is not an administrator who believed in hearsay or rumours, but down to earth with fair hearing.
